    A few years ago, a friend was looking at rental properties to move house. She picked out two and showed me pictures on her phone. One of the photos was of a kitchen and there was a big orb in the photo. My friend knew well of my intuition/knowing and asked me what I felt, whilst she was swiping through the images of the bedroom, front room, front garden.

    I remember telling her that I felt the location itself was great but I was getting bad vibes from the place. Space was important to her and the flat was quite a good size for a one bedroom. She made her decision and there was no stopping her. She agreed to take on the apartment which was attached to a dentist.

    We helped her to move in , carrying boxes, helping to put the bed together. As soon s I walked in, I felt physically sick and felt heavy as if something was in the air weighing me down. The atmosphere was awful in the front room but worse in the bedroom. I was in there putting the bed slats together for her and felt like I was being watched the whole time. The
    room had no window and was a basement bedroom so it was enclosed and dark and it was quite horrible. But it was her new home so I played along being happy for her new start despite my feelings of the place.

    We left hugged her goodbye and the next day we checked in to see how her first night was. “Bloody awful” she said. We asked why and she mentioned that she hadn’t slept a wink because she felt someone was stood next to her bed, felt someone tapping her when she had finally managed to drift off. It happened so often that her tenancy lasted around a week and she took the next available apartment that would accept her. She moved out fast and had to pay huge fees for breaking her contract.

    Once she left she was told that nobody stayed there for long as they experienced the same and the home actually belonged to Harold Shipman (Dr) Who had a doctor surgery above. He killed his patients there and in the community.

    It could have been resolved but I think knowing the history pt people off wanting to stay there. For my friend however she had no history of the place only knowing it was Victorian and close to amenities.

    “Harold Frederick Shipman, known to acquaintances as Fred Shipman, was an English general practitioner and serial killer. He is considered to be one of the most prolific serial killers in modern history, with an estimated 250 victims.”
